Data centers play a crucial role in storing, managing, and processing vast amounts of data for organizations across various industries. One of the key components of data centers is the database, which is essential for storing and retrieving data efficiently. In recent years, there have been numerous successful implementations of data center databases in various industries, showcasing the importance of having a robust database system in place.
One industry that has seen significant success with data center databases is the financial services sector. Financial institutions rely heavily on data to make informed decisions, manage risk, and comply with regulations. With the implementation of advanced database systems, financial institutions can store and analyze massive amounts of data in real-time, enabling them to provide better services to their customers and improve operational efficiency.
Another industry that has benefited from successful implementations of data center databases is healthcare. With the increasing digitization of medical records and the need to store and analyze patient data securely, healthcare organizations are turning to data center databases to manage their data effectively. These databases enable healthcare providers to access patient information quickly, make accurate diagnoses, and provide personalized treatment plans.
The retail industry is another sector that has seen successful implementations of data center databases. Retailers use databases to store customer information, track inventory, and analyze sales data to improve marketing strategies and enhance customer experiences. With the help of data center databases, retailers can gain valuable insights into consumer behavior, streamline operations, and increase profitability.
In the manufacturing industry, data center databases have been instrumental in streamlining production processes, tracking supply chain activities, and optimizing inventory management. By centralizing data storage and integrating various systems, manufacturers can improve production efficiency, reduce costs, and enhance product quality.
Overall, the successful implementations of data center databases in various industries highlight the importance of having a reliable and scalable database system in place. With the increasing volume of data being generated and the need for real-time access to information, organizations must invest in robust database solutions to stay competitive and meet the demands of today’s data-driven world. By leveraging data center databases effectively, organizations can drive innovation, improve decision-making, and achieve sustainable growth in their respective industries.
